Incident Summary:

10/24/2019: Assailants opened fire on apple truck drivers in Chitragam, Jammu and Kashmir, India. Two drivers were killed and another driver was injured in the attack. This was one of two related attacks in Chitragam on the same day. No group claimed responsibility for the incident; however, sources attributed the attack to Hizbul Mujahideen (HM) and Lashkar-e-Taiba (LeT).
